The Algeria Airborne LiDAR Market is experiencing steady growth driven by increasing demand for high-resolution mapping and surveying applications across various sectors, including urban planning, infrastructure development, and natural resource management. The market is characterized by a rising adoption of LiDAR technology due to its ability to provide accurate and detailed geospatial data, particularly in challenging terrain and inaccessible areas. Key players in the market are focusing on technological advancements to enhance the efficiency and accuracy of LiDAR systems, catering to the evolving needs of industries in Algeria. Government initiatives to promote digital transformation and modernization of infrastructure are also contributing to the market`s expansion. Overall, the Algeria Airborne LiDAR Market is poised for continued growth in the coming years, driven by the increasing awareness of the benefits of LiDAR technology in various applications.

In the Algeria Airborne LiDAR market, some of the key challenges include limited awareness and understanding of LiDAR technology among potential end-users, regulatory hurdles related to data collection and privacy concerns, as well as the high initial costs associated with LiDAR systems. Additionally, the lack of skilled professionals proficient in LiDAR data processing and analysis poses a challenge for companies looking to effectively utilize LiDAR data in various applications. Furthermore, the rugged terrain and harsh weather conditions in Algeria can make data acquisition and processing more challenging, requiring specialized equipment and expertise. Overcoming these challenges will require targeted education and training efforts, collaboration with regulatory bodies to address concerns, and strategic investments to develop the necessary infrastructure and capabilities in the market.

The Algerian government has not implemented specific policies directly targeting the Airborne LiDAR market. However, the country has been focusing on infrastructure development which indirectly benefits the LiDAR market. The government has been investing in various sectors such as agriculture, urban planning, and natural resource management, which are key areas where LiDAR technology can be utilized effectively. Additionally, Algeria has been promoting foreign investment and partnerships in its development projects, which could create opportunities for LiDAR technology providers to enter the market. Overall, while there are no specific policies targeting the Airborne LiDAR market in Algeria, the government`s focus on infrastructure development and openness to foreign investment could create a conducive environment for the growth of the LiDAR industry in the country.
